Data Migration Engineer
Job Description
Salary: £60,000 - 90,000 per year
Requirements:- Strong data extraction and scripting skills, including SQL and a scripting language such as Python
- Experience with data profiling, cleansing, de-duplication, and metadata/schema mapping across disparate, messy sources
- Comfort reconciling structured and unstructured data from multiple systems into one clean data set
- A methodical, detail-obsessed approach focused on data accuracy, traceability, and repeatability
- Good judgement on when to escalate rather than infer, especially with ambiguous, incomplete, or sensitive records
- Experience handling confidential or commercially sensitive data professionally and securely
- Lead a time-boxed data migration project to extract, profile, clean, de-duplicate, and migrate executed contracts into a new internal repository
- Inventory every source system, produce record and document counts, and assess data quality, access routes, and risk
- Write and run scripts to pull documents and structured or unstructured metadata in bulk from multiple systems
- Consolidate source data into a single staging dataset and apply documented rules for duplicate resolution
- Build and populate a metadata register against agreed core fields, explicitly flagging gaps rather than inferring or leaving blanks
- Run a sample migration to test and refine mapping logic and transformation rules before scaling up
- Execute the full bulk migration into the new repository structure using the agreed schema and naming convention
- Produce clear documentation and handover notes covering what was migrated, what could not be migrated and why, anomalies, and the scripts and logic used

More:
We are building a brand-new internal contract hub to replace our legacy contract tracking tools. This is a short-term contract of approximately 30 days on a day-rate basis, outside IR35, and remote within the UK. You will work across multiple disconnected sources, including eSignature platforms, a legacy SQL database, SharePoint, and old ticketing systems, to create a single reconciled and trustworthy dataset. This role is focused on data quality and data engineering, with a strong emphasis on traceability, repeatability, and auditable migration.
